Description
The RP-1 and RP-2 rate measurement units provide 2 axis angular rate in digital(RS422) and/or analog outputs. Both units are identical except for variations in performance. The units consist of a 2 axis dynamically tuned gyro; 2 electronic boards that operate the gyro; d.c. to d.c. power conversion to supply +/- 15 volts from the unregulated +28 volt input; and 2 semiconductor accelerometers to compensate the gyro acceleration dependent bias and provide data that can be used to calculate inclination angles. All the above are installed in a hermetically sealed housing. The housing provides 2 reference mounting surfaces for the user, as shown in the attached drawing. The gyro sensing axis are aligned to reference mounting surfaces. The rate measurement units can also be connected in a rate integrating mode for use, as an example, for platform control. Other options include changes in sensing axis orientation, and variations in scale factor and bandwidth.
